Sony has miniaturized all of the usual components to make the Vaio UX Micro one of the smallest portable in the world! The tiny notebook runs on either a Intel Core Solo 1.06GHz (UX50) or 1.2GHz (UX90) Ultra Low Voltage CPU and is packaged into a 150mmx95mmx32mm (520g) carbon fiber frame. Its 4.5″ (1024×600) WSVGA) touchscreen may be too small for some but it also boasts a built-in 1.3 megapixel camera, 802.11 a/b/g wireless, Bluetooth 2.0 and a biometric fingerprint sensor. The laptop is operated using the included stylus and lasts 3.5 hours on the standard battery - you can get double that on the extended battery.
